We can now weed around the spinach and the broad beans too…. We are down to loading our table with produce just on a Friday so I’ve been prepping the parsnips and squash. Unfortunately the squash aren’t keeping especially well. Whether this is due to this years particular conditions; the variety of the seed or the way we are storing them, we will have to see.

We are on the lookout for kaput chest freezers, if anyone knows of a clean one that is on its way to the tip? They come highly recommended for storage of root crops and the like. (Removing sections of the seal to allow air flow)
